Hi I'm a first time user to the forum, but ive been reading the website for months, and i also bought the book.
Ive been collecting nectar points slowly for about 2 years, through doing my weekly shopping at sainsburys and petrol from BP (or sainsburys)but since getting the nectar credit card from american express my points have rocketed. Me and my wife pay for all our food and petrol on this joint card, then pay the full balance each month, which keeps our own money in our account longer to gain a little intrest. We have now reached 71,000 points and our aim is 101,000 points so we can claim a 24" phillips LCD TV for free. So 5,000 is a good start to get you on your way.
